Top Features of the Hope Pro 3 Clincher Rear Wheel
The entry level wheelset in Hope's Hoops RS range. Combining strength, lightweight and reliability - this combination is a great wheelset for those needing a wheel to train, race, tour or just RIDE on!
- CNC machined in Barnoldswick, England
- Built and hand finished in Barnoldswick, England
- Bearing type: Cartridge (61803, 17.28)
- Hub Body: 2014 T6 aluminium
- Colours: Black
- Hole Drilling: 32
- Cassette body: (Shimano or Campagnolo)
- Ratchet type: 4 pawl (24t engagement)
- Weight: Open Pro Front Rear 915g, Stans Alpha Front Rear 891g
- Road
- Weight (g): 915
- Wheel Size: 700c (622)
Hope use a combination of the benchmark Mavic Open Pro rim and Sapim Sprint spokes which are hand laced, machine built and hand finished in house using Sapim Polyax Brass nipples onto Hope's proven and reliable Mono Pro3 hubs.
This gives a smooth and free running wheel which will survive endless miles of regular use.
The resulting package is light enough to race, strong enough to train and reliable enough to complete sportives and tours on. Wheels come individually or as a pair and come complete with custom ‘Hope Hoops’ etching on the hub, rim tapes, spare spokes, nipples and rim stickers.
About the Hope brand
Hope are makers of CNC precision cycling components such as braking systems and accessories, hubs, bottom brackets, wheelsets, lights, stems, headsets, quick releases, tools and cycle clothing and merchandise. Hope has for many years sponsored many of the World Cup teams in downhill and cross-country. Their own team has become a formidable force in the United Kingdom and on the World Cup scene, allowing them to test their bicycle parts at the highest level. Hope is a company working at the leading edge of engineering technology, they use the most advanced materials and computer aided design techniques to produce bicycle components of unrivalled quality.
